Type
ORACLE
Validation date
2025-09-28 03:01: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(41 B)

{
  "uco": {
    "eur": 2.0122e-4,
    "usd": 2.3544e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001209DD6524CFC1BF32660EF86B5BA298606D3A31351E9A9B178839EAEC58196F7

Previous signature

D9C5253777D33D6A512DC6480AF401D4A819E5A6D7BE2AE9BD952A64DE914F6FC7F768BD577A5C776F19C0B7D75D3417970B14E7C379A9C4FD1ED51FD5559201

Origin signature

304602210082AE527FDD93633020970026F8F6A3B3DBD73CA8FB606FBF73994F03E0E258E5022100E7D7B718C4776E3AA798B8472250B851701A35598208FDDE42BFF594161D2EBB

Proof of work

01020451684966573439C38DA99334546FBBDE4A6D96A50B4A4ECBB6572CDBED023F079607407E254421D1779525D11C60D55684F0B403B93B95823554E29D1E2CDB16

Proof of integrity

00432C5ABFD65C97C9C90E33CBD33EB46FF90ACA47F5BE22BFFF48DF1124CAFBCE

Coordinator signature

3C5CF59942ADE8BDB5190D26DD1B6F360347AFF1863A37253F68B8184581077D57A0B3A65180465DD2E1D3F31CD19EC93A52D76A00BE99FBB3A4F921CE94340F

Validator #1 public key

000134C0EC1A10E466EAEF43BF20464C614B4FB1D4E7BD8FD72F107D756638FE43AB

Validator #1 signature

510702838907688ABD35FCDE1AE87F14E1E90A50F1F7A285DD08BA7F3F7B9345EB67FDD4A5C9BE95B35C9070C99E74BCD10C4B8A498CBA02293E5C9053608C04

Validator #2 public key

00013979F182FBF100A7D850091072443374862E8A007B24B5E14A1405B1F3B1F406

Validator #2 signature

820F9F4811C3C5A344461009C7FFDA38F2D9C573F693AEFD7D9A6FB251FAFD44C3B652CDC9DC76D5AD7D00313E986A55C1BD4F0AC92BCA38A5C27BAEAEB2690C